If you have proof of purchase, you should be able to prove it's your device. I'm not sure how your phone got compromised, perhaps either your Samsung or Google account was compromised.  I'm sorry, I have no experience with managed devices, so I can't be of more help.  I have seen that people had managed devices that they owned, but allowed their company to manage, and forgot to tell the IT people to unmanage it when they left and had a difficult time of it (but that was a case where, apparently, the user could not remember which employer put the management on the phone).

 

I know it would be expensive to do so, but if I were you, I'd go to an uncompromised device, transfer any personal data out of my Google and Samsung accounts, change the account password and then create new accounts and buy a new phone.  I don't know how many devices you have that you currently own and are affected, but you may just have to turn them off and trash them and get replacements registered to your new accounts.  For good measure, I'd also request a new phone number, or at least a new SIM card. It's tedious and expensive, but sometimes it's the only way. How much is your personal and financial data worth to you? I have heard that the only way for management to be removed is by the person who put it on in the first place. But, as I said, I am not an expert on device management.
